Mavs Gaming Star Dimez Inks Deal to Become Hyper X Heroes Ambassador

Two days before the season three NBA 2K League draft, Hyper X made a pick of its own when it announced that Mavs Gaming star Dimez would be joining the Hyper X Heroes Ambassador Program. A connection between the first overall pick in the inaugural season of the NBA 2K League and the company that manufactures the only headset you’ve ever seen him wear in the league was, seemingly, a matter of time. Mavs Gaming Announces Partnership with DUDE Wipes

Mavs Gaming has partnered with DUDE Wipes in a deal that makes DUDE Wipes the team’s jersey patch partner for the 2020 season, the team announced Tuesday. With every parent NBA team enjoying revenue from having a company advertising patch on their jerseys, Mark Cuban decided to hop into the fray with a slightly different approach. NBA 2K League Finals Preview: T-Wolves Gaming vs 76ers GC

T-Wolves Gaming and 76ers GC square off in the NBA 2K League Finals. A point guard battle between BearDaBeast and Radiant will determine the 2019 champion. After 12 weeks of regular-season action and three in-season tournaments, the NBA 2K League Finals have arrived. T-Wolves Gaming will take on 76ers GC in what will be a best-of-five series taking place Saturday. At the end of the night, the second-ever league champions will be crowned.
